Market Snapshot: Antibacterial Glass Market Size and Growth
The antibacterial glass market grew from USD 429.75 million in 2024 to USD 478.59 million in 2025. It is expected to continue its robust development at a CAGR of 11.12%, reaching USD 999.12 million by 2032. This sector is being shaped by innovations in ion-infusion and antimicrobial coating technologies, broadening antibacterial glass adoption across industries. Stringent health standards and changes in global trade policy are influencing supply dynamics and competitive strategies, while regulatory developments and consumer confidence play an increasingly important role in market expansion.

Assessing Tariff Impacts on Antibacterial Glass Supply Chains
Recent US tariff measures have added complexity to the sourcing of raw materials and specialized compounds used in antibacterial glass. In response, manufacturers are focusing on vertical integration, local sourcing, and supply chain diversification to reduce cost volatility and ensure the continuity of antimicrobial glass solutions for domestic and global markets.
